Host: Bill Cullen

The Dean of game show hosts, Bill Cullen

Announcer: Don Pardo

Airdates: NBC daytime July 1, 1974-January 3, 1975

Origination: Studio 6A, NBC, New York


On Winning Streak, two contestants competed against one another to spelled words in a desired category from a pool of 16 letters from the alphabet. Each letter had a different poiont value. A player won the points and the letter by successfuly answering a question. The first person to complete a word won the game, and avanced to the money board , where he or she formed words using letters chosen at random. The prize money doubled as each letter was selected. The game continued until either a player quit, thus securing all acquired winnings, or failed to form a word using all letters selected.
